Jet Aviation Expands Service Capabilities at its Hawker Pacific Facility in Cairns

Jet Aviation’s Hawker Pacific facility in Cairns, Australia (YBCS), has received FAA authorization to install its aural alerting equipment on aircraft at the facility. This approval extends the company’s exclusive arrangement with Pratt & Whitney Canada for engine prognostics equipment service and support. Development of the alert system, including the looms and installation hardware, was completed exclusively at Hawker Pacific Cairns.

The Hawker Pacific Auxiliary Aural Alerter System alerts pilots when an aircraft engine is about to exceed its operating limitations, enabling pilots to act quickly to avoid costly engine damage. The system integrates with the Diagnostics, Prognostics and Health Management (DPHM) unit on P&WC equipped aircraft to provide tones and voice callouts to the pilot’s headset, directing them straight to the area of concern.

Hawker Pacific Cairns has worked closely with P&WC to gain international approvals for retrofitting aircraft with P&WC products, with the “on aircraft” engineering development and trial installations completed in Cairns. During the development process, Hawker Pacific gained expertise in the product resulting in the team travelling internationally to install the P&WC systems on aircraft in countries such as India, Indonesia, Nepal, Japan and China.
